[Buildroot] [PATCH] redis: use BR2_TOOLCHAIN_HAS_LIBATOMIC
Peter Korsgaard
peter at korsgaard.com
Mon Mar 28 20:40:07 UTC 2016
>>>>> "Gustavo" == Gustavo Zacarias <gustavo at zacarias.com.ar> writes:
> It uses __atomic_fetch_add_4 so libatomic must be pulled in if
> necessary. Fixes:
> http://autobuild.buildroot.net/results/dfd/dfdfd77463b0ddd7016202372afcad7fb6fc9ce4/
> # Redis doesn't support DESTDIR (yet, see
> # https://github.com/antirez/redis/pull/609). We set PREFIX
> # instead.
> -REDIS_BUILDOPTS = $(TARGET_CONFIGURE_OPTS) \
> +REDIS_BUILDOPTS = \
> + CC="$(TARGET_CC)" \
> + CFLAGS="$(TARGET_CFLAGS)" \
> + LDFLAGS="$(TARGET_LDFLAGS) $(REDIS_LIBATOMIC)" \
> PREFIX=$(TARGET_DIR)/usr MALLOC=libc \
On second thought, I prefer to keep this as TARGET_CONFIGURE_OPTS
instead of explicitly passing CC / CFLAGS, so I've changed that while
committing.
--
Bye, Peter Korsgaard
More information about the buildroot
mailing list